The Innovation Network Committee is an internal organization established in order to make objective and neutral decisions regarding the investment projects to be conducted by INCJ, Ltd. Because INCJ, Ltd. is managed under the similar framework based on the Industrial Competitiveness Enhancement Act, the Committee is composed of INCJ representative directors and external directors. The corporate auditor also attends meetings of the Committee.
